Trigeneration and SCR: Spumador produces water and beverages efficiently, respecting the environment
Case history
Installed in 2012 and having undergone a full overhaul in 2019, the Spumador trigeneration plant, beverage company owned by the Refresco brand, is divided into 3 modules. The plant has an electrical power of 3 MW and it also produces steam and water that are used in the production process; it also allows Spumador to save 60,000 tons of CO2, equivalent to 50,000 cars. In 2019, the revamping of the cogeneration system also provided for the installation of an SCR system designed to help reduce C02 emissions and to keep them within the limits set out by the Lombardy region.
